Output 3084e21a831df16419febd642f6003f21fcffb233c9f11cb46d62b176baf827a:1

value
2604122
script pubkey
OP_0 OP_PUSHBYTES_20 07b3d8559c2fbf8d5d9d932617c18ee9c6443041
address
ltc1qq7eas4vu97lc6hvajvnp0svwa8rygvzp2w2kgc
transaction
3084e21a831df16419febd642f6003f21fcffb233c9f11cb46d62b176baf827a
spent
true